METHOD OF MAKING HIGHER THERMAL STRENGTH HEAT-RESISTANT CERMET COAT |
摘要 |
FIELD: metallurgy.SUBSTANCE: method of making proposed coat for aircraft and rocket gas turbines and combustion chambers comprises application of alternating ceramic and metal plies on working surface by ion-plasma spraying. First metal ply is applied on said surface. All metal lies are made of identical-depth nickel, depth making at least 4 mcm. Ceramic different depth plies are made of zirconium oxide stabilised by yttrium oxide. First ceramic layer, if seen from working surface, features depth of at least 1-2 mcm. Every next ceramic ply features the depth increased by 2-3 mcm Outer surface ceramic layer features depth of 20-30 mcm.EFFECT: higher thermal strength and heat resistance.1 dwg, 1 ex |
